The fact is, depending on how they form, waterspouts come in two types: tornadic and fair weather. A tornado begins over land, while a tornadic waterspout develops over water or moves from the land. The main difference is in where they form. ![]() ![]() "The belief that a waterspout is nothing more than a tornado over water is only partially true. To start, they are both columns of rotating air. According to a post on, a waterspout is defined by the National Oceanic and Atmospheric Administration (NOAA) as "funnel which contains an intense vortex, sometimes destructive, of small horizontal extent and which occurs over a body of water." 'Tornadic waterspouts', also accurately referred to as 'tornadoes over water', are formed from mesocyclones in a manner essentially identical to land-based tornadoes in connection with severe thunderstorms, but simply occurring over water.
